ViewSonic introduced 2ms LCD monitor and claimed it to to be the world's fastest LCD monitor. The fame only apparently held for a couple days, as now BenQ also announces a 2ms LCD monitor.
The ViewSonic VX922 is a 19 inch monitor with 2ms response time that will be available in China first.
The BenQ FP93G X is also a 19 inch monitor and utilizes the BenQ Advanced Motion Accelerator (AMA) technology to reach 2ms response times.
The BenQ FP93G X will start selling next month in Asia.
Not sure if a 2ms response time is a reason to go out and buy a new LCD monitor when it starts selling near you. It just shows that response time is soon no distinguishing issue anymore in the next couple of years. I do not have an issue with response time even today.
